S8 Data from the publication of Nef et al. in PLOS Biology entitled "Whole-genome scanning reveals environmental selection mechanisms that shape diversity in populations of the epipelagic diatom Chaetoceros". (A) Pairwise FST values of ARC_116. (B) Pairwise FST values of ARC_217. (C) Pairwise FST values of ARC_232. (D) Pairwise FST values of PSW_256. (E) Pairwise FST values of SOC_37. (F) Median pairwise FST matrix of ARC_116. (G) Median pairwise FST matrix of ARC_217. (H) Median pairwise FST matrix of ARC_232. (I) Median pairwise FST matrix of PSW_256. (J) Median pairwise FST matrix of SOC_37. (K) Mean median pairwise FST matrix of the MAG populations located in Arctic Ocean regions.
